Why did Dickens write Oliver Twist?

1 answer
2024-09-26 18:40

Dickens was a famous British writer in the 19th century. He wrote the novel Oliver Twist, which told the story of an orphan living and growing up on the streets of London. There were several reasons why Dickens wrote Oliver Twist: Reflect social reality: Oliver Twist is one of Dickens 'representative works that reflect social reality. In the novel, Dickens revealed the injustice, darkness and cruelty of the society by describing the social customs of London, which reflected the greed, selfishness and cruelty of human nature. 2. Shaping the characters: Dickens created many distinct characters in Oliver Twist, showing the good and evil, good and bad, and complexity of human nature through their actions and words. These characters had unique personalities and characteristics that left a deep impression on the readers. 3. Exploring human nature: In Oliver Twist, Dickens explored the good and evil, morality, and responsibility of human nature through describing the experiences of the protagonist Oliver. Oliver experienced poverty, loneliness, misunderstanding, suffering and other pains in the social environment of London, but he finally chose justice and kindness, which reflected Dickens 'concern and thinking about human nature. To sum up, the main reason why Dickens wrote Oliver Twist was to reflect social reality, shape the characters, explore human nature, and also express his concern and thinking about human nature.
